#3fa58a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3fa58a is composed of 24.7% red, 64.7% green and 54.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.4%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 164.1 degrees, a saturation of 44.7% and a lightness of 44.7%. #3fa58a color hex could be obtained by blending #7effff with #004b15.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#3fa58a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3fa58a has RGB values of R:63, G:165, B:138 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.16,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 4171146.

Shades and Tints of #3fa58a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030907 is the darkest color, while #fafd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3fa58a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b7975 is the less saturated color, while #02e2a7 is the most saturated one.
